India hosted Iran’s deputy foreign minister on Wednesday amid a bid to boost connectivity and political ties, days after external affairs minister S Jaishankar hosted his counterparts from the United Arab Emirates and Syria.

“Pleased to receive Iranian deputy foreign minister for political [email protected]_Kani. Discussed our bilateral cooperation, regional issues and JCPOA,” Jaishankar tweeted following his meeting with Kani.

Connectivity via the International North-South Transport Corridor and Chabahar Port figured high on the agenda of the meeting, said people aware of the matter. Southeast Asian countries including Vietnam are also keen to use the Chabahar Port to push trade ties in the region.
